]> git.armaanb.net Git - asd-repo.git/commitdiff
mpv: don't bootstrap waf, and use lua 5.2
authorArmaan Bhojwani <me@armaanb.net>
Wed, 30 Jun 2021 14:35:39 +0000 (10:35 -0400)
committerArmaan Bhojwani <me@armaanb.net>
Thu, 1 Jul 2021 00:02:04 +0000 (20:02 -0400)
mpv/build
mpv/checksums
mpv/depends
mpv/sources

index 2985c49887db543b6b3ac656f023a5fdd957862e..299287c435e574538aabb790553c2f44e5bbb6a7 100755 (executable)
--- a/mpv/build
+++ b/mpv/build
@@ -1,14 +1,14 @@
 #!/bin/sh -e
 
-./bootstrap.py
+ln -s waf-2.0.18 waf
 
-./waf configure \
+python waf configure \
     --prefix=/usr \
     --mandir=/usr/share/man \
     --confdir=/etc/mpv \
     --enable-alsa \
     --enable-lua \
-    --lua=luajit
+               --lua=52
 
-./waf
-./waf install --destdir="$1"
+python waf build
+python waf install --destdir="$1"
index 773e232ac646925365cf37f22a86ef59658c229d..ba4d1cf241f12a5b301552f2aa5b17c25c39e147 100644 (file)
@@ -1 +1,2 @@
 100a116b9f23bdcda3a596e9f26be3a69f166a4f1d00910d1789b6571c46f3a9
+2e0cf83a63843da127610420cef1d3126f1187d8e572b6b3a28052fc2250d4bf
index 6642a509c4f26ec1fd96363e46435fc92d22c28b..9d96ea4a7ed5aa4e51a3e01c88cb7b793b1b1444 100644 (file)
@@ -1,11 +1,11 @@
 alsa-lib
 ffmpeg
 freetype-harfbuzz
-libass
 libXScrnSaver
 libXinerama
 libXrandr
-luajit
+libass
+lua
 mesa
 pkgconf make
 python  make
index ff4fbfa985297bfb5c4bcd38c0d4f1914ff5dcd7..0c3bd28ef620aa67cfacc85ce676f727e536eed3 100644 (file)
@@ -1 +1,2 @@
 https://github.com/mpv-player/mpv/archive/v0.33.1.tar.gz
+https://waf.io/waf-2.0.18